Pros

- Training is quite good (trainer was very helpful with introducing data science concepts)

Cons

- Management always mentions employment opportunities after graduating from training program, however its been about 6 months and nothing to show for (they say on the website its 6 weeks which is outrageous false advertising) - Total lack of transparency from management and engagement team when it comes to the current status of interview opportunities - On the off chance of there being an interview opportunity, candidates have 24 hours or less to prepare and are told 'this is how it is'. There are still some of us that have not had any interviews yet!!!!
